Biographical / Historical

Oxfam, with Channel 4 and several other organizations, created the On the Line project in 1999-2001. It focused on connections between people living in countries along the Greenwich Meridian, as part of the Millennium celebrations.

The Oxfam (India) Trust, a U.K. charity, was set up in 1978 to take responsibility for funds which Oxfam remitted to India for development and humanitarian work. The Oxfam (India) Society was also set up in 1978, for the purpose of receiving income for Oxfam's work in India, mainly the repayment of loans made by Oxfam (India) Trust for micro-credit, reimbursement of tax paid on expatriate salaries by the Trust, and donations from the public in India. In the late 1990s, the Oxfam (India) Society began to operate under the name Oxfam India.
